<self-uri xlink:href="http://www.scielo.org.co/scielo.php?script=sci_arttext&amp;pid=S2011-21732021000100016&amp;lng=en&amp;nrm=iso"></self-uri><self-uri xlink:href="http://www.scielo.org.co/scielo.php?script=sci_abstract&amp;pid=S2011-21732021000100016&amp;lng=en&amp;nrm=iso"></self-uri><self-uri xlink:href="http://www.scielo.org.co/scielo.php?script=sci_pdf&amp;pid=S2011-21732021000100016&amp;lng=en&amp;nrm=iso"></self-uri><abstract abstract-type="short" xml:lang="en"><p><![CDATA[ABSTRACT The effects of different nitrogen doses on dry weight yield, stevioside and rebaudioside A contents, and yields were evaluated in stevia (Stevia rebaudiana Bertoni). This study was carried out at the Instituto Federal Catarinense, Rio do Sul (SC), Brazil, under decreasing photoperiods. A randomized complete block design with four blocks and five treatments (0, 65, 135, 200 and 270 kg ha-1 N) was used. Variables related to dry weight yield (total dry weight, leaf dry weight, stem dry weight, number of secondary branches and tertiary branches, and main stem length), growth rates (total leaf area, leaf area index, specific leaf area, leaf area ratio, leaf weight ratio), and stevioside and rebaudioside A contents and yields were evaluated. The doses of nitrogen fertilization did not affect the variables related to dry weight yield, stevioside and rebaudioside A contents and yields, or rebaudioside A:stevioside ratio in stevia genotype 8 (G8), grown under decreasing photoperiods.]]></p></abstract>
